The Swedish Driver's License System Explained


Sweden's method to motorist licensing shows the nation's commitment to road security and environmental responsibility. read more under the Transport Agency (Transportstyrelsen), which oversees all licensing matters and keeps extensive standards for both candidates and driving schools.

The Swedish driver's license can be found in several classifications, with the B license being the most frequently sought. This classification permits people to drive traveler lorries with an optimum weight of 3,500 kgs. For bike enthusiasts, the A license pathway needs additional training and testing, while industrial vehicle operations demand specialized licenses with their own unique requirements.

What differentiates the Swedish system from lots of others is its emphasis on competency over easy evaluation death. Authorities anticipate candidates to show not just technical driving capability however likewise risk awareness, environmental consciousness, and the psychological readiness to deal with challenging traffic scenarios. This holistic technique contributes to Sweden's remarkably low traffic fatality rates, which consistently rank among the most affordable worldwide.

Vital Requirements for Applicants


Before beginning the licensing process, candidates need to fulfill certain essential criteria established by Swedish authorities. Understanding these requirements early prevents wasted time and resources throughout the journey.

The most fundamental requirement concerns age. For a standard B license, applicants need to be at least eighteen years old. Nevertheless, individuals can begin the learning process earlier, participating in traffic education programs from age sixteen. Those seeking motorcycle licenses can start at age sixteen for the A1 classification, with complete A license access reaching age twenty-four or through progressive development through lower classifications.

Identity paperwork forms another important requirement. Swedish residents need to supply valid national identification, while worldwide applicants normally need a passport and house authorization (uppehållstillstånd) demonstrating legal status in Sweden. The documentation verification process guarantees that all licensed motorists can be correctly determined and tracked within the nationwide system.

Medical physical fitness represents a non-negotiable element of the Swedish licensing procedure. All applicants need to go through a health evaluation conducted by a licensed doctor, who assesses vision, cardiovascular health, neurological function, and other elements appropriate to safe driving. Certain medical conditions may result in restricted licenses or extra monitoring requirements, however these are assessed on a case-by-case basis.

The Step-by-Step Process


Stage One: Theory and Preparation

The journey towards a Swedish motorist's authorization begins with theoretical education. Candidates must complete necessary traffic theory coursework, normally used through certified driving schools (trafikskolor). This education covers Swedish traffic laws, roadway signs, danger understanding, environmental driving factors to consider, and the mental elements of safe decision-making.

During this phase, students should pass a theory assessment administered by the Transport Agency. This computer-based test provides situations and concerns assessing the candidate's understanding of traffic rules and safe driving principles. The evaluation is offered in several languages, though Swedish and English remain the most commonly selected alternatives.

Stage Two: Practical Training

Following successful theory assessment completion, candidates go into the practical training stage. Swedish guidelines mandate a minimum variety of driving lessons with certified instructors, though the majority of experts recommend significantly more practice than the legal minimum. The necessary training consists of particular workouts covering everything from standard automobile handling to intricate traffic scenarios.

A vital part of Norwegian-inspired training involves risk education (riskutbildning). This specialized instruction addresses risks that end up being more hazardous as driving proficiency increases, consisting of high-speed driving, disability effects, and tiredness. The threat education program combines class conversation with useful presentations, often consisting of monitored high-speed driving on closed courses.

Phase Three: The Driving Test

The final difficulty includes the useful driving test (körprov), which assesses the candidate's ability to operate a lorry securely in real traffic conditions. An inspector accompanies the prospect throughout approximately thirty to fortyfive minutes of driving, assessing technical abilities, decision-making, and overall preparedness for independent driving.

The test begins with a lorry safety inspection, where applicants must demonstrate understanding of their lorry's maintenance needs and safety features. The driving portion then proceeds through numerous traffic environments, consisting of property locations, crossways, highways, and roundabouts. inspectors evaluate not just whether candidates total maneuvers properly, however whether they do so safely andconsiderately towards other roadway users.

Time requirements fluctuate considerably based on individual ability and practice frequency. The theoretical stage normally requires two to four weeks of concentrated study, while useful training covers two to 6 months for most applicants. Consisting of waiting periods for examination scheduling, the total procedure typically requires four to 8 months from initiation to license receipt.

Important Warnings: Recognizing Illegal Schemes


Potential motorists need to stay alert versus deceitful plans guaranteeing “Swedish motorist's authorizations for sale” or expedited licensing without appropriate screening. These deals usually represent scams, unlawful activities, or both. Several important considerations safeguard applicants from harm.

Acquiring a counterfeit or fraudulently acquired license makes up a criminal offense in Sweden, possibly leading to fines and jail time. Beyond legal effects, people using deceitful licenses face extreme complications including insurance coverage invalidation, automobile impoundment, and potential criminal charges if associated with mishaps. The threats far outweigh any viewed benefit or expense savings.

Authentic Swedish licenses need completion of all mandatory training elements and passing both theoretical and practical examinations. No genuine pathway bypasses these requirements, no matter guarantees made by deceitful sellers. The Transport Agency keeps sophisticated verification systems that rapidly recognize deceptive files, making their usage both unsafe and virtually useless.

Genuine driving schools provide agreements detailing all services, fees, and timelines. Requests for cash payments, pressure to make fast choices, or guarantees of results without standard procedures signal possible scams. Candidates should verify school licensing through official channels and report suspicious deals to suitable authorities.

Frequently Asked Questions


The length of time is a Swedish motorist's license legitimate?

Swedish motorist's licenses are usually valid until the holder reaches seventy years of age, after which renewal requirements include medical accreditation. However, license holders must update their license if they change their name or if the license is lost or harmed.

Can I drive with my foreign license in Sweden?

Visitors and new locals might drive with legitimate foreign licenses for approximately one year of residency. EU/EEA licenses stay legitimate forever in Sweden, while licenses from non-EU countries need conversion within this 1 year period if residency continues longer.

What if I stop working the driving test?

Failed tests incur no long-term consequences, and candidates might retake after a compulsory waiting period of usually two weeks. Statistics indicate that first-time pass rates hover around sixty percent, making preparation and expert instruction valuable financial investments.

Is the Swedish driving test conducted in English?

While the preliminary theory examination offers English language options, the practical driving test is performed mainly in Swedish. Nevertheless, examiners might use standard English vocabulary when needed, and candidates might bring interpreters for certain portions of the assessment procedure.
